Dean Wood is a self-taught wood fabricator, designer, CNC’er and creator who loves learning new things every day. Dean is always looking to add a modern twist to his projects and the inspiration behind this mallet was to create something multi-material and multi-purpose that functions as a practical woodworking tool and also looks cool with some extra fun features thrown in! In today's digital age, many woodworkers and DIY enthusiasts are turning to social media platforms to share their projects and tips and Dean is always grabbing his phone to take a quick picture or film a little clip of what he’s up to in the workshop. This gave Dean the idea to make his custom mallet with an integral thumb grip and phone stand giving you a handy way to keep your phone at a convenient angle to access all your favorite apps or music, and make it easier to record videos or watch tutorials while working in your shop!
In this video, Dean shows you how he crafts his mallet with the magic of Aspire to build up the design, using the sheets function to organize each component. Using 3D profile tools with neat shortcut keys, vector trimming, bezier curves and node mirroring, he creates the thumb grip and phone stand features to add character and function to the mallet. After making the prototype, Dean then uses pocket and profile machining to cut each side of the handle and mallet head plus the dowel fixings in beautiful Padauk and Maple, gluing each side together and adding Rubio oil as a finishing touch to make the Padauk pop!
